
Valira d'Orient is the eastern branch of the Gran Valira river that crosses the heart of Escaldes-Engordany, adding a soothing natural backdrop to the urban landscape. Along its banks, scenic pathways invite leisurely strolls while the nearby Pont d’Engordany—an elegant stone bridge—grants a glimpse into Andorra’s rich heritage. Dating back to the 18th century, it once connected local settlements and now serves as a cultural landmark. Explore the surrounding neighborhood, dotted with quaint shops and restaurants, and enjoy the town’s famous thermal waters, renowned for their mineral-rich properties and healing benefits.
